SB 889 West Virginia Senate · 2025 Regular Session

Creating Sustaining Opportunities for Academics in Rural Schools Act

SB 889 proposes to modify West Virginia's requirements for establishing public charter schools by adding detailed application standards. The bill mandates that applicants submit comprehensive materials including mission statements, student achievement goals, governance structures, enrollment plans, five-year budgets, and facility descriptions. These requirements apply to all entities seeking to create or convert schools into public charters, including rural districts. The bill is currently in the Senate Education Committee for review as introduced on March 24, 2025.
